Zermatt at the foot of the Matterhorn is one of the most famous mountain resorts in Switzerland. At around 1,600 metres above sea level, the town offers its almost 6,000 inhabitants a distinctive alpine environment and a distinctly high quality of life.
With the new building on Stalden, six high-quality primary residence apartments are being built south of the village centre. The chalet in alpine style with wooden façade combines modern construction quality with typical local architecture.
The building comprises six 3.5-room residential units, including two attic apartments. Each apartment offers a spacious balcony, terrace or forecourt with a direct view of the alpine mountains.
